Condition: Good. * Colorado hikes within an hour of Interstate 25 south from Denver, Colorado Springs, Pueblo, Walsenburg, and Trinidad* Guidebook covers trails where few other hikers go* Full-color trail maps and photosA number of hikers contacted us to say that they loved our book, The Best Front Range Hikes but they wanted more hikes south of Denver to the New Mexico border. For the southern edition, we asked the project manager of The Best Colorado Springs Hikes to hike, write, and photograph a guidebook for the Southern Front Range.The Best Southern Front Range Hikes includes 65 of the most superb hikes found anywhere in Colorado. The hikes were chosen for a number of reasons including the beauty of the scenery, the variety of terrain, the quality of the hiking experience on the trail, and the fact that many of these trails don't get used as much as the trails in other parts of the state. Some are close to town while others are more remote. Many make excellent family hikes while others challenge the seasoned mountaineer. All hikes in this guidebook can be done in a day from at least one of the cities listed above.Each trail description starts with some basic information about the hike including elevation gain, difficulty level, and round-trip distance and time. These statistics are followed by comments on what to expect on the hike, directions to the trailhead, and a complete trail description, including photos from the route and a color topo of the trail.
